### Account Recovery — Catalogue Import (Lintwood)

Quick one for review: when the Lintwood catalogue import wipes a patron's session table, the recovery flow re-seeds accounts from the nightly snapshot. Check that the importer skips locked accounts — last time it didn't. To rerun recovery against staging you'll need the vault passphrase, which is appended just below.

recovery phrase for yafof-tajof: julmir-kelax-julvan-holath-belvan-holir-ralael-ralvan-ralath-julvan-silmir-istmir-kaswyn-ulamir

Subject: Partner SFTP drop — new owner

Hi,

As you review the pending changes to the Harborline ingest scripts, note that ownership of the partner SFTP drop is changing at the end of the month. This includes key rotation, the nightly pull job, and the quarantine folder for malformed files. Review comments on the retry logic should still go through the normal PR flow, but questions about drop-folder conventions or partner onboarding now go to the new owner. The incoming owner is listed below.

signatory, tagaf-bahaf: Praael Fenmir Rusok

Ticket: Config drift on PortionWise prod

The recipe-scaling calculator in production no longer matches the baseline committed last quarter. Rounding mode and unit-conversion precision were changed outside the deploy pipeline, and the audit trail is incomplete. Requesting security review of the unapproved changes before we reconcile. For reference, the current live configuration values are as follows.

service settings:
PRAIX_LOG_LEVEL=error
PRAIX_METRICS_HOST=metrics.praix.qorvelcorp.corp
PRAIX_POOL_SIZE=16

Onboarding — firmware channel (Ketterby devices). The stable channel ships updates to Ketterby units every other Thursday; beta is continuous. Never push unsigned images — devices hard-reject them and brick recovery takes hours. Promotion from beta to stable requires two maintainer approvals in the Larkspur console. All stable images are signed with the key below.

deploy key for yajeg-hahog: bky3_BZq